Output d662532ae5a3e4e4fbedc3393f163a06093cc13bc577d360a544a35f36506994:0

value
993812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 972959dacdc22d8edde7db435a94794f51cb207e OP_EQUAL
address
3FUHVdMeYYhjYzpymboUBSvXDAbhnjuswg
transaction
d662532ae5a3e4e4fbedc3393f163a06093cc13bc577d360a544a35f36506994
spent
true